Does anyone know a modem string that will allow a Hayes Accura 336 + fax modem to work with Compass software. The string that is in the software for the Accura 336 accesses the modem but tells me the modem is not responding. Any help would be appreciated.
I'm not familiar with Compass, but a reasonable guess is that either the response format is set wrong (numbers vs. text), or the manner in which DTR is used is incorrect. Obvious commands to try are ATV0Q0X1 which you can try out in Hyperterminal, or (software of your choice). Just be sure your Compass software doesn't overwrite your values or ATZ the modem (reset).
Could also be an Echo problem, but I doubt it. ATE0 or ATE1 should rule out that possibility.
You can short pins 2 & 3 on the modem for a loopback test. That will at least rule out the modem's UART electronics as one possible problem. The Hayes Accura 336 is a very capable modem. I'm sure it will do what you want. You just have to play with it to decipher the strings.
On the plus side, the Hayes command set is very well documented. Shouldn't take too long to get it going.. Famous last words?
